In the central courtyard of SUISHOEN is an elegant old building that was once the country home of the Mitsui family. Built in 1925, this magnificent structure is not just beautiful - it's a piece of history, listed as a Registered Cultural Asset by the Japanese government. It was transported here from its original location to serve as both the literal and the aesthetic center of SUISHOEN. With its old-time feel and prewar atmosphere, the building is an elegant and timeless venue for dining in the Momiji restaurant and relaxing in the lounge.
SUISHOEN's interior design is a modern take on traditional design. Carefully placed artworks and elegant furniture provide both a Japanese sense of place and warm, comfortable surroundings. Traditional design elements, such as Edo karakami - a kind of paper that has been popular for centuries for decorating sliding doors and walls - grace the interiors of the ryokan's 23 rooms with ancient accents.

  • Bath SUISHOEN's baths are, of course, fed by its own source of the famous Hakone onsen hot spring. This water feeds the baths in SUISHOEN's rooms, all of which have rotemburo outdoor baths. There is also a public bathing area with enormous ofuro bathtubs - one rotemburo in the open air, set in a pretty garden, and one inside, both big, comfortable granite tubs.
  • Cuisine SUISHOEN's Momiji restaurant offers kaiseki Japanese haute cuisine, as well as teppanyaki, which the chef cooks on a heavy iron griddle as customers sit at the counter and watch; his ingredients vary with the season, and may include steak, shrimp, okonomiyaki (a type of savory pancake), and yakisoba (panfried buckwheat noodles). The menus change every month to ensure freshness as well as to mark the seasons in the traditional way - a practice that enhances both the flavor and the meaning of the food, as well as your enjoyment of the timeless surroundings.
    In the relaxed, elegant atmosphere of the century-old building that Momiji calls home are 24 tables, expert chefs and an attentive staff who will make your meals here an experience to remember. In-room meals are also available.

  • Lobby In the finely kept grounds are bamboo rock gardens surrounded by pine forests and bamboo copses; a magnificent 300-year-old maple tree spreads its boughs over the grounds. The traditional low roof tile-topped wall recalls the site's past and enhances the timeless atmosphere of elegance, serenity and quiet.
    The Shop has some particularly fine examples of yosegi-zukuri, the Hakone area's lovely and distinctive parquet-style ornamentation, on boxes, tableware, chopsticks and other items.
